Key Dimensions of a 30 ft Container
A 30-foot shipping container is a relatively unusual size; most containers are constructed in standard lengths of 20 ft or 40 ft. Nevertheless, its specs align closely with those of its more typical counterparts. Here are the basic dimensions one can anticipate from a typical 30-foot shipping container:
External Dimensions:
Length: 30 ft (9.14 m).
Width: 8 ft (2.44 m).
Height: 8.5 ft (2.59 m).
Internal Dimensions:.
Length: 29.5 ft (8.99 m).
Width: 7.7 ft (2.34 m).
Height: 7.9 ft (2.39 m).
Cargo Volume: Approximately 1,300 cubic feet (36.87 cubic meters).
Tare Weight: Usually around 4,200 lbs (1,905 kg), though this can vary a little based on the maker.
Maximum Payload: Typically 26,300 pounds (11,900 kg).

Advantages of 30 ft Containers.
Picking a 30 ft container over more basic sizes can provide a number of benefits:.
Optimal Space Utilization: The 30 ft container offers extra length compared to the basic 20 ft design, providing more space to accommodate larger products while still being compact enough for smaller sized deliveries.
Versatility: The container can be adapted for various uses, including storage, mobile offices, and even living spaces. Its distinct size produces opportunities for ingenious adjustments.
Transportation Efficiency: This size can fit in both standard shipping setups and special loading situations, making it a versatile choice for logistic companies.
Cost-efficient: For services needing a larger storage solution but desiring to avoid the costs connected with 40 ft containers, a 30 foot shipping container cost ft container can strike a balance, permitting appropriate area at a more manageable cost.
Environmental Impact: Reducing the frequency of shipping by enhancing load sizes can assist minimize the carbon footprint related to transport. A 30 ft container can be especially effective for medium-sized deliveries and playing a role in sustainability efforts.
Typical Uses of 30 ft Containers.
The adaptability of a 30 ft container helps with a wide range of uses, including however not restricted to:.
Storage Solutions: Ideal for businesses that require a protected location for excess inventory, seasonal products, or equipment.
Workshops or Offices: These containers can be modified with insulation, power, and windows, making them suitable for short-lived workplaces or mobile workplaces.
Short-lived Housing: With correct adjustments, 30 ft containers can serve as short-lived real estate for workers at building and construction sites or other remote places.
Emergency Relief Housing: In disaster-stricken areas, customized containers can quickly act as shelters for displaced families.
Exhibits or Event Spaces: They can be used for pop-up stores, exhibitions, or occasion areas, versatile to various styles and branding requirements.

2. What are the expenses connected with a 30 ft high cube container for sale ft container?
Prices can differ widely based on the condition (brand-new or utilized), area, and provider. Typically, purchase costs can range from $3,000 to $7,000, while rental rates might differ from $100 to $400 per month.
